Nestled in the heart of Genoa, Via Del Campo 29 Rosso is a captivating art museum that celebrates the city’s rich cultural heritage. This unique destination merges art, literature, and music, making it a must-visit for tourists seeking a deeper understanding of Genoa's artistic soul. From book collections to vintage records, the atmosphere is steeped in creativity and history.

Nestled in the vibrant streets of Genoa, Via Del Campo 29 Rosso stands as a testament to the city’s rich cultural tapestry. This unique art museum is not just a gallery; it’s a celebration of the arts that blends the realms of visual aesthetics, literature, and music. As you step inside, you are greeted by an eclectic mix of artworks, collectibles, and a charming bookstore that invites you to explore the literary treasures of Italy. The museum's layout is both inviting and informative, with exhibits that showcase local artists and poignant historical narratives. Visitors can immerse themselves in the vibrant artistic community of Genoa, discovering the stories behind each piece and the cultural significance they hold. Whether you are an art enthusiast or a casual visitor, the engaging displays will undoubtedly captivate your imagination and inspire a greater appreciation for the artistic endeavors of the region. In addition to the visual arts, Via Del Campo 29 Rosso also features a remarkable collection of vintage records, reflecting the musical heritage of Italy. This unique combination makes it a perfect stop for those looking to connect with the local culture on multiple levels. The friendly staff is more than willing to share insights about the exhibits, making your visit not only enjoyable but also enriching. Don’t forget to stop by the bookstore, where you can find rare publications and souvenirs to take home, ensuring that your experience in Genoa is as memorable as the city itself.
